増える

ふえる
hepburn fueru

to increase (intransitive)

Part of speech · ichidan-verb

Examples

  1. 最近、外国人の観光客が増えています。
    Recently, foreign tourists have been increasing.
  2. 体重が少し増えました。
    My weight has increased a little.

Mnemonic

増える fueru — kanji 増 (to increase) + the ichidan ending える. Intransitive: a number or amount rises on its own, subject marked by が. Its transitive partner is 増やす (fuyasu, to increase). The opposite flow is 減る (heru, to decrease), the intransitive pair of 減らす. 増 is the shinjitai form.
